KeyWheel is Thornbeck Systems' internal tool for rotating service secrets on a fixed schedule. It reads rotation policies from the `keywheel_policies` table and writes audit entries to `keywheel_events`. As a contractor, you'll mostly interact with it via the CLI; direct database access is only needed when debugging a stuck rotation. Rotations run nightly, and failures page the platform on-call. Both tables live in the shared ops Postgres cluster. For troubleshooting sessions, connect using the read-write ops string below.

primary connection of yagep-kahip = redis://giliel_svc:zYiKsLL2PLpfPL@db-348f.xolmarsys.corp:5432/fenwyn

MEMO — Dispatch Desk

Three sealed water samples pulled from Harlow Basin reservoir this morning by the Verrick Utilities field crew. Chain-of-custody slips attached; do not break seals. Samples must reach the Calder Street lab before 14:00 or they expire and the whole run repeats. Cooler stays upright, no stacking. Courier pickup is booked for 11:15 sharp from the loading bay. Log departure time on the board as usual. The hand-over instruction for the courier follows below.

handover note for bajog-tawig: the lamion quenael courier leaves the wendor ledger at gate 1289 under passcode 760784

## Authentication

Heads up: the nightly reindex job (`reindex_nightly.py`) talks to the Lanternfish search cluster, and that cluster won't accept anonymous writes anymore — we locked it down last sprint. The job now authenticates as the `reindex-runner` service identity against Corvid Gateway, and the token is injected via the `LF_INDEX_TOKEN` env var in the scheduler config. Nothing clever going on, just a bearer header on every batch request. For review purposes, the staging credential currently in use is listed below.

service key, kadug-kadup: kto15_rN23XLAYImmZgrJ

TICKET: Kiosk watchdog restarts app during idle screensaver

The Tarnwell kiosk watchdog interprets the screensaver's paused render loop as a hang and force-restarts the shell every twenty minutes. Customers see a flash and lose session state. Fix extends the heartbeat to the idle process. Please hold the rollout until verified; the candidate token follows.

build token for tawip-yageg: htk9_92ac43d42